At least four people were killed on Saturday after a passenger vehicle plunged off a road near Sojha in India's northern state of Himachal Pradesh, ANI reported, citing district officials.
The vehicle was carrying 22 passengers, including 2 children, when it met with the accident, the report said.
Officials said the fatalities included two men and two women, while eighteen people were rescued and are undergoing treatment, the report added.
